Pre-Defined Sample Reports |
Stonefield Query comes with several pre-defined sample reports. These reports are automatically added to your list of reports the first time you run Stonefield Query. You can delete any you don't wish to use. To re-add a pre-defined report you've deleted, choose the Import function from the File menu, move into the Sample Reports subdirectory, and select the desired report.The following reports come with Stonefield Query.
- Customers.sfx: Labels for customers. This label prints all four lines of address, so it requires a 1.5 inch high label.
- Customers - Short.sfx: Labels for customers. This label only prints the first two lines of address, so it fits on 1 inch high labels.
- Drilldown Child - Sales Order Details.sfx: This sample report is an example of a child report in a linking situation. The Drilldown Parent - Sales Orders report is linked to this report, so clicking a sales order number in that report will display this report for that sales order.
This report can be run directly as well, like any other Query report, but generally it is run through the parent report.
- Drilldown Parent - Sales Orders.sfx: This sample report demonstrates Stonefield Query's ability to link reports. This report shows sales orders, and is linked to the Drilldown Child - Sales Order Details report. Clicking on an order number in this report will display that order's details using the sales order details report.
- Email and Website Linking.sfx: This simple customer report demonstrates Stonefield Query's ability to link email and website addresses in reports. The email and website fields in this report are set as linked fields, so you are able to launch a new email message or web browser by clicking them in the preview window.
Note that this report is set to only display the first 200 customers. This is simply to prevent the report from displaying a very large number of customers.
- Employees.sfx: Labels for employees. This label prints all four lines of address, so it requires a 1.5 inch high label.
- Employees - Short.sfx: Labels for employees. This label only prints the first two lines of address, so it fits on 1 inch high labels.
- Exclusion Filter Sample.sfx: This report shows an example of an exclusion filter. The report prompts for a date range, and shows a list of customers who do not have any sales orders in that range.
- GL Postings.sfx: This report shows GL postings by the source ledger.
- Inactive Inventory Items.sfx: This report shows inventory items, along with information about the last time they were purchased.
- Job Information.sfx: This report shows information about jobs, including income, expense, and profit.
- Job Transactions.sfx: This report prints job transactions by job and account.
- Line Chart - Sales by Month.sfx: This line chart report shows total sales for each month. The results are based from the sales order invoice total field. The report includes a filter on the order date, so the results can be restricted to a particular date range.
- Pie Chart - Sales by Salesperson.sfx: This pie chart report shows total sales for each salesperson. The results are based from the sales order invoice total field. The report includes a filter on the order date, so the results can be restricted to a particular date range.
- Sales Orders.sfx: This report shows sales order details.
- Sales Orders by Salesperson.sfx: This report shows sales order information grouped by salesperson.
- Top Sales by Part Number.sfx: This summary report shows total sales for each part number. The results are sorted using the extended price from the sales order detail, so the parts are listed in order of the largest total sales. The report includes a filter on the order date, so that the results can be restricted to a particular date range.
- Top Sales by Salesperson.sfx: This summary report shows total sales for each salesperson. The results are sorted using the total amount from the sales header, so the salespeople are listed in order of the largest total sales. The report includes a filter on the order date, so the results can be restricted to a particular date range.
- Two Year Monthly Client Sales Comparison: This report will display 24 months summary information from Sales History, showing the monthly totals for each customer. The second set of 12 months is compared to the first, giving the percentage change for the same month in each year. When the report is run, it will prompt for the starting date of this 24-month period.
- Vendor List.sfx: This report shows a concise listing of vendors.
- Vendors.sfx: Labels for vendors. This label prints all four lines of address, so it requires a 1.5 inch high label.
- Vendors - Short.sfx: Labels for vendors. This label only prints the first two lines of address, so it fits on 1 inch high labels.
